1. Choose the Right Booster for Travel
Not all high-back boosters are created equal when it comes to portability. Look for a model that is lightweight, has a compact fold, and includes a carrying handle or strap. If you’re flying, check that your booster is FAA-approved for aircraft use. Many high-back boosters are approved, but always verify the label. A seat that works both in the car and on the plane saves you from renting a bulky seat at your destination. 2. Packing Your Booster Seat Like a Pro
Packing your high-back booster seat correctly can save you time and frustration at the airport or in the car. Start by removing the seat pad and any detachable parts, like the headrest or armrests. Store these in a separate bag to prevent loss. Use a car seat travel bag—many are padded and have backpack straps—to protect the seat from scratches and dirt.
Label your bag with your contact information in case it gets misplaced. For road trips, secure the booster in the trunk or cargo area using bungee cords or a cargo net to prevent it from sliding around. If you’re renting a car at your destination, pack the seat in a sturdy bag that can double as a laundry sack for dirty clothes on the way home.
- Use a travel bag with a shoulder strap for hands-free carrying through terminals.
- Pack the LATCH belt and manual in a zippered pocket attached to the bag.
- If checking the seat at the airport, consider using a padded cover to avoid damage.
3. Installation Tips for Rental Cars and Airplanes
Installing a high-back booster in an unfamiliar vehicle can be tricky. Always carry a printed copy of the car seat manual (or save it on your phone) because rental car seat belt configurations vary. Practice the installation at home before your trip so you’re confident. For boosters used with a lap-and-shoulder belt, ensure the belt lies flat across your child’s chest and hips.
On an airplane, place the booster seat in a window seat and secure it with the aircraft seat belt. The booster must be used only for children who meet the weight and height requirements. If your child is under 40 pounds, a 2-in-1 car seat in harness mode is safer. - Check the rental car’s seat belt length—some are too short for boosters.
- Use a towel or pool noodle to level the booster if the vehicle seat is deeply contoured.
- Never install a booster seat in a seat with a side airbag that deploys from the seatback.
4. Keep Kids Comfortable and Entertained on the Go
Long trips can be tough on little ones, especially when they’re strapped into a booster seat. Dress your child in comfortable, thin layers so the harness or seat belt fits snugly without bulky clothing. Bring a neck pillow and a small blanket for naps. 5. Safety Checks Before Every Drive
Before you pull out of the driveway or leave the airport, do a quick safety check. Ensure the booster seat is tightly installed with no more than 1 inch of movement at the belt path. Check that the harness or seat belt is at or below your child’s shoulders for rear-facing (if applicable) and at or above for forward-facing. The chest clip should be at armpit level.
Inspect the seat for any damage from travel, such as cracks in the plastic or frayed straps. If you’re using a rental car, verify that the seat belt locks properly. - Perform the pinch test on the harness strap—if you can pinch excess webbing, tighten it.
- Check that the vehicle seat belt is not twisted or routed incorrectly.
- Make sure the booster’s headrest is adjusted to the correct height for your child.
